Emily spent her youth in Mississippi and Tennessee and graduated in 1943 from Mississippi State College for Women (now MUW). Following college and during WWII, she served in the US Marine Corps Women's Reserve at headquarters in Washington D.C. Following the war; marriage brought her to Clarksville, Arkansas. She became a homemaker and derived great satisfaction in volunteer work related to her church and family. A lifelong Presbyterian and Elder, she was active in Presbyterian Women's work and served on groups at the Presbytery level. In relocation to Little Rock, she resided at Parkway Village and continued to enjoy volunteer service and programs offered by Life Quest. She was a member of Second Presbyterian Church.
